
The Vive Alternating Air Pressure Mattress Pad is designed to help prevent and relieve bed sores (pressure ulcers) in individuals who are bedridden or have limited mobility. It works by evenly redistributing weight and alleviating pressure points using an alternating air-cell system — offering a practical solution for home care or hospital settings. The mattress pad is waterproof, hypoallergenic, latex-free, and supports up to 300 lb (approx. 136 kg), making it suitable for a wide range of users.

Pressure redistribution efficiency: The ability of the mattress to spread a person’s weight over a larger surface area, minimizing the sustained pressure on any given point (which reduces risk of sores).
Alternation frequency and air-cell design: How the mattress cycles pressure (inflate/deflate) matters: slower or poorly designed cycles can reduce effectiveness. Uniform, controlled cycles are ideal.
Comfort and noise level: For long-term use (sleep, rest, recovery), the mattress should be comfortable and avoid disturbing noise levels (for pumps, air movement).
Durability and weight support: Should support the patient’s weight reliably over time without leaks or air-cell failures. Materials should be waterproof / easy to clean to maintain hygiene.
Ease of setup / compatibility: Should fit standard beds, be easy to install (pump hookups, hoses), and ideally be usable on existing mattresses or frames.

The mattress uses 130 air cells that alternately inflate and deflate, which “evenly distributes a patient’s weight and relieves pressure spots” — preventing the constant pressure that leads to bed sores. Without effective pressure redistribution, the mattress loses its core therapeutic value, making it no better than an ordinary mattress. Moreover, proper cycle timing and cell design help maintain circulation and skin integrity over extended periods of immobility.
